Joliet drive-by shooting leaves 2 wounded

JOLIET, Ill. – Two men were wounded in a motorcycle drive-by shooting Monday morning in southwest suburban Joliet.

What we know:
The men, 36 and 44, were outside an apartment building around 12:45 a.m. in the first block of North Broadway Street when someone started shooting from a passing motorcycle, according to police.
The 36-year-old was shot twice in the leg and the 44-year-old suffered a gunshot wound to the ankle. Both victims were treated at the scene and taken to St. Joseph Medical Center with non-life-threatening injuries.
Police said spent shell casings were recovered from the scene.
No arrests have been made. Police said the motive for the shooting is under investigation.
